I don't agree that most parishes don't start until 1602. The majority of Beds parishes - 74 out of 131 - on the IGI  start before 1600 and there are more eg Clifton, where the IGI starts at 1602 but the transcript starts earlier (the IGI isn't taken from the transcript).

BTs started in 1598 and I suspect that this might be the reason for a number of parishes not starting until 1602- the PR has been lost and the IGI is taken from the BT
